IMF Survey: Greece Needs Deeper Reforms to Overcome Crisis

December 16, 2011

  • Greece receives €2.2 billion following approval of program review
  • Program is in a difficult phase, with reforms proceeding slowly
  • Discussions on private sector involvement to ease debt burden continue

Despite year-long efforts to revive the economy at the heart of Europe’s sovereign debt crisis, Greece remains mired in a deep recession.
